What are the swimming strokes?
Breaststroke is a swimming stroke that imitates frog swimming. Breaststroke is more suitable for novices, easy to learn and master.
1. The power source of breaststroke mainly relies on stirring the legs. The speed of breaststroke is moderate, which saves energy.
Freestyle is the fastest stroke.
2. Freestyle has a very reasonable posture, low resistance and the most streamlined. The main source of power in freestyle is the arms paddling and breathing through one's face swinging one's head to either side.
3. Butterfly swimming technique is evolved on the basis of breaststroke technical movement, because its movement is like a butterfly fluttering in the water, so it is called butterfly swimming.
